ABSTRACT
The trainee (Noele Certain) is a PhD student who is starting her 3rd year of graduate training in the
Graduate Program in Molecular and Cellular Pharmacology at Stony Brook University. Noele’s long-term
goal is to maintain an independent research lab in parallel with a teaching career – she wants to be a
strong role-model and mentor to other underrepresented minorities. I believe my laboratory will provide
the necessary environment for Noele to achieve her career goals. Specifically, my laboratory and its
surroundings will provide Noele with a strong intellectual and technical environment; she will study
scientific issues of great clinical importance (structure/function and cell biology of AMPA receptors); she
will obtain rigorous training – an issue of fundamental importance for any scientist; she will be given
guidance but also considerable freedom so that she can develop and mature as an independent scientist;
she will be given numerous opportunities to present her data in public forums, both locally and nationally;
and finally she will be given opportunities to teach undergraand mentor undergraduates under my
guidance. With a rigorous but broad background in molecular and cellular pharmacology, Noele will be
well prepared to pursue her goal of a research career and to research any topic that may be appropriate
as she develops her own research lab. In addition, she will be well placed to act as a mentor for
undergraduate and graduate students including underrepresented minorities.
